There is something to be said about Etymology and the meaning of names.  Today in our culture we often select a name because we just like it, it sounds good, or maybe it is a namesake after a relative. Seldom do we select a name based on the meaning and etymology of the word, but this was very important in many cultures including in the cultural study of the people of the old testament scriptures. In fact, when a significant event happened in someone's life, often a name was changed afterwards to commemorate that event-- Abram to Abraham, Jacob to Israel. If you have ever been around me you have heard me say "not all translations are equal" or "not one translation is perfect"... There are some that are definitely more accurate, but still not perfect. This hits some Christians hard...remember God's Word is perfect but God never said all the translations going forwards or backwards (from our current date) would be. There is this one movement, King James Only, that has been around for a few years, but I am sorry the King James Translation is not perfect either.  Here is just one example.
